An open side stops being a feature around October and becomes the reason a structure goes unused. Closing it in 16mm multiwall polycarbonate is the least complicated fix, and for most people it is also the right one.

The sheet sits in a slim powder-coated aluminium frame in projections of 2.5m, 3m, 3.5m and 4m, in opal, clear, ultra-clear or solar-control, and it works under any veranda whatever the brand.

Multiwall means hollow rather than solid, so it is light to handle and insulates properly.

It closes a side of your veranda, taking the wind and driving rain off that face while still letting daylight through. It is a side element for an existing structure rather than a freestanding garden screen.

The aluminium frame is made to sit under most veranda types rather than one brand's system, which is unusual for a side element. Send us your projection and post spacing and we will confirm.

Opal diffuses the light and gives privacy with it. Clear keeps the view and the most light. Ultra-clear is the closest to glass. All three are 16mm multiwall, so the choice is about light and privacy rather than strength.

Polycarbonate is lighter and far harder to break, and 16mm multiwall insulates better. Glass is clearer and heavier. Both close a side properly against the weather.
